## Authentication

To push crash reports from your plugin into the Splintr pipeline, you'll need a key for our internal ingest service. Keys are scoped per plugin, so don't share them between projects — we rate-limit per key and you'll just throttle yourself. Rotation happens quarterly; we'll ping you. For local testing against the sandbox ingest endpoint, use the key below.

gateway credential: vxb4-QTMv

## Session Handling for Webhook Retries

Heads up, reviewers: the Pipewren delivery service retries failed webhooks with exponential backoff, capped at six attempts over two hours. Each retry reuses the original session context, so signatures stay stable across attempts — don't regenerate them. Consumers verifying retried payloads against the sandbox should authenticate requests with the bearer token below.

session JWT of yawep-yawep = eyJhbGciOiJIUzI1NiIsInR5cCI6IkpXVCJ9.eyJzdWIiOiI3pWF3_In0.aXYsHiog

Attendees: heads of department, chaired by Ms. Oldervik.

Quick recap: launch date holds for early spring. Packaging samples from the Twyford workshop were approved with minor tweaks. Marketing wants two more weeks for the teaser campaign — granted. Retail pricing stays as proposed; Finance flagged freight costs to the Calderport region as a watch item. Next check-in is in a fortnight. Everyone should also read the confidential planning note appended just below these minutes.

confidential, bahif-yagug: Gross margin on Druath came in at 20 percent against a plan of 10 percent. Only 7 of the 80 pilot accounts renewed Druath, so a churn review is set for October 15.

### Log sampling on Pipewren

When Pipewren floods the aggregator, enable sampling via the admin API rather than restarting the service. Set sample_rate to 0.1 for bursts, restore to 1.0 afterward, and note the change in the ops journal. The sampling endpoint requires authentication; use the bearer token below.

bearer token for kawig-yajef: eyJhbGciOiJIUzI1NiIsInR5cCI6IkpXVCJ9.eyJzdWIiOiI8HQhnz97dxIn0.tsXu5Xf2tmo0